Understanding the Architecture of Login Systems
At its core, a login system serves as the gateway to a platform’s ecosystem. It involves a series of complex processes: credential verification, session management, multi-factor authentication, and recovery protocols. Each component is interlinked, emphasizing the importance of a seamless, error-resistant environment. The Impact of Login Failures on User Trust
Even isolated login disruptions can significantly erode user confidence. In sectors like online banking or digital trading platforms, a login failure is not merely an inconvenience but a potential risk to trust and transactional security. Customers now expect instant resolutions and continuous accessibility — any glitch can open the door for reputational damage and churn. As such, developers are prioritizing resilient login architectures paired with sophisticated troubleshooting tools.

Emerging Solutions and Best Practices
| Strategy | Description | Industry Example |
|---|---|---|
| Multi-Factor Authentication (MFA) | Enhances security by requiring additional verification steps. | Financial institutions adopting biometrics alongside passwords. |
| Progressive Rollout & Testing | Gradual deployment of updates with comprehensive testing to prevent failures. | Major social media platforms rolling out new encryption protocols. |
| User-Centered Troubleshooting Portals | Empowering users to diagnose and resolve issues independently. | Customer support interfaces integrating real-time diagnostic tools. |
